琼脂糖珠法对显微切割样本的高效基因分析:十二指肠固有腺体息肉和异位胃黏膜中β-连环蛋白基因的改变。

Efficient Genetic Analysis of Microdissected Samples by Agarose-Bead Method: Alterations of β-Catenin Gene in Fundic Gland Polyp and Heterotopic Gastric Mucosa of Duodenum.

Abstract

Molecular genetic analyses of archival formalin-fixed, paraffin-embedded (FFPE) pathological specimens taken at biopsy or autopsy, are occasionally compromised because the DNA molecules therein are inevitably degraded. Furthermore, since these tissue samples comprise various cell types, the analyses based on mixtures of such heterogeneous populations often fail to reflect the nature of the affected cells. In the present study, to elucidate the contribution of β-catenin gene mutation to the fundic gland polyp and the heterotopic gastric mucosa in the duodenum, we successfully introduced an agarose-bead mediated technique as an effectual tool for retrospective morphology-oriented genetic analyses. Microdissected samples were embedded in low-melting agarose, and directly treated with proteinase K. A fragment of the agarose-bead was used as a template for polymerase chain reaction to analyze β-catenin mutation. Of the six cases of heterotopic gastric mucosa in the duodenum associated with fundic gland polyps, one showed a common 1-bp missense mutation at codon 37 shared by both the fundic gland polyp and the heterotopic gastric mucosa. Alternatively, a 1-bp silent mutation at codon 33 and missense mutation at codon 32 were identified only in the heterotopic gastric mucosa. Agarose-bead mediated technique shows superior sensitivity to the previously described techniques and is an effectual tool for retrospective morphology-oriented genetic analyses using a large number of archival pathological samples stored for long periods in the pathology laboratory.

摘要

对存档的福尔马林固定、石蜡包埋(FFPE)病理标本进行分子遗传学分析,偶尔会受到影响,因为其中的 DNA 分子不可避免地会降解。此外,由于这些组织样本包含各种细胞类型,基于这些异质群体混合的分析通常无法反映受影响细胞的性质。在本研究中,为了阐明β-连环蛋白基因突变对胃底腺息肉和十二指肠异位胃黏膜的贡献,我们成功地引入了琼脂糖珠介导技术,作为一种有效的回溯性形态学遗传分析工具。微切割样本被嵌入低熔点琼脂糖中,并直接用蛋白酶 K 处理。琼脂糖珠的片段被用作聚合酶链反应的模板,以分析β-连环蛋白突变。在与胃底腺息肉相关的 6 例十二指肠异位胃黏膜中,有 1 例在密码子 37 处显示出共同的 1 个碱基错义突变,该突变存在于胃底腺息肉和异位胃黏膜中。此外,在异位胃黏膜中还发现了 1 个密码子 33 的同义突变和 1 个密码子 32 的错义突变。琼脂糖珠介导技术的敏感性优于以前描述的技术,是一种有效的工具,可用于对大量长期存储在病理实验室中的存档病理样本进行回溯性形态学遗传分析。
